Lambda layers exceed quota - how to fix?

1

When add layers (Python libraries in my case) to a Lambda Function, I receive the below error. Do any of you know how to resolve? I need the libraries within those layers' zip files. Thank you - Brendan

"Layers consume more than the available size of 262144000 bytes"

Hi Brendan,

Lambda has a 250MB Deployment package hard limit. We can see this here in our Documentation under "Deployment package (.zip file archive) size". This limit cannot be increased.

You can try to remove unneeeded packages in the Deployment package to ensure that it is within the limit. If that is not possible, the recommendation is to use Lambda with EFS as discussed here in our blog.

As mentioned by Lambda, total Lambda deployment size can't exceed 250MB when using the ZIP file deployment method. However, Lambda now supports also container images. Those can be up to 10GB in size. So instead of using layers, just include all the libraries in the docker image.
